New research from Sky Mobile has revealed how in spite of purse strings being tighter this year, over 86% of Brits still want to give back to others this Christmas, and nearly a quarter (24%) are planning to help through acts of kindness and good deeds.
As the season for giving, nearly half (48%) are planning to be more charitable this year than before, and a third (35%) will give back with monetary donations. Over 1 in 4 (27%) are also looking to other means to spread cheer; from buying charity Christmas cards (28%) to donating their loved but unwanted items such as clothes and toys (26%) to charities.
To help people find alternative ways to do charitable gestures this holiday, Sky Mobile has partnered with the NSPCC, so from today, customers can support the charity by exchanging 30GB of their spare data to help fund NSPCC services such as Childline.
Sky Mobile is hoping to reach 210,000GB through customers’ spare data donations which Sky Mobile will turn into a £70,000 donation to the NSPCC – the equivalent to the cost of funding Childline for two days.

Truly a nation spreading good cheer, over 4 in 5 (92%) believe it’s important to give back, with the caring, Christmas spirit driving December to be one of the most popular months, year on year, to generously donate (86%).
With Brits typically donating their time or money, and even doing acts of kindness 4 times a year, it seems the public are spurred on by their belief that everyone in society should support those less fortunate (47%), alongside feeling it’s important to spread positivity (41%).
And with many looking to make savings where possible this year, it’s been revealed over two thirds (68%) would be willing to donate more to charities if they knew there were alternative options, such as swapping their mobile data for a donation (72%).

Kirsty Lawson, Associate Head of Corporate Partnerships at NSPCC said: “As the Christmas school holidays are fast approaching, we are gearing up to keep our 13 Childline bases open 24/7 over the festive period. December and January are common months for children to confide in Childline about abuse for the first time, so it is vital the service is there whenever a child chooses to disclose. Thanks to Sky Mobile and their customers’ generous donations to help fund our services like Childline, our counsellors will be ready to answer and listen to anyone’s call this holiday season.”
